Ricoh mp3002 mac issiue
i pick up a copier and prints out fine with windows but when i print from mac you can see data light come on but nothing prints out. user code is not turn on copier. its prints fine with windows but not mac.

Re: Ricoh mp3002 mac issiue
You need to make sure the copier actually has the PostScript CHIP installed. Go into User Tools/Counter>Printer, and see if you have an index tab labelled "PS". If you don't see that, you don't have PostScript installed.
When installing the PS printer drivers on Macs, you need to run the installer package first, then go into Apple>System Prefs>Printers, and add the device. The method that's always worked for me is one...
Choose IP Printer....
Enter the IPv4 address
Select Line Printer Daemon
Queue is "lp" (no quotes)
Name is whatever you like
Select Printer Software, and browse for the make/model of the machine.
Once that's done, go into CUPS using your browser and typing localhost:631, and use it to configure default options,

Re: Ricoh mp3002 mac issiue
If you do not have the PS3 SD card install, you should be able to set it up as a generic PCL printer, depending on the version of OS X. Only drawback is on most OS X it only prints B/W.
